Mirror from old rackets



A very simple matter. Take old rackets, remove all the fishing line from inside, measure the glass to size, cut it out and insert it inside. For reliability, you can place the mirrors on silicone so that they stay firmly inside the racket.

The wooden frame itself can be painted in any color to suit your interior.



Stylish lamp made from an old hat

If you have an old grandpa hat that probably won't be worn by anyone, it can easily be repurposed into a fun lamp. To do this, you need a cord, a socket, a light bulb and some electrical knowledge.



Book shelf



Everyone has books at home that no one reads anymore, but they have been collecting dust on the shelves for many years. Why occupy shelves with them if they themselves can make original shelves for small things. Buy colored paper

and wrap it around books, making them bright and cheerful. Using three fasteners, attach the “shelves” to the wall. Well, the new piece of furniture is ready and almost free.

Second life of an old piano

It's no secret that selling a heavy piano or grand piano in the era of synthesizers is very difficult. But it's not that difficult to convert it into a rack. You need to throw out all the internal parts, paint in the middle, attach shelves and enjoy your originality.

Fish house



Often, to have an aquarium with fish, you need certain furniture with a fairly durable tabletop. But if you already have an old non-working TV, you can remove the kinescope and other parts from it and put an aquarium in its place. Since the frame of the TV is very durable, it will easily support the weight of the “fish house”. And you will have a 24-hour television program “In the Animal World.”

Let's sit on the path



Transforming an old suitcase into a cozy chair takes some time and skill. First you need to make legs or figure out how to replace them.



Then sew soft pillows or buy them in the store. By placing pillows inside, you get a small chair.



Place it near the wall so that you don’t have to worry too much about making a frame for the back of such a piece of furniture.

Original hooks



If you have old, unwanted wrenches, or your DIYer has an excessive amount of them, turn them into fun hooks. Drill two holes in them, attach them to the wall and hang things with pleasure. Keys can be painted different colors to make it look much more fun and brighter.

Unusual watch



Remove the old bicycle wheel from the inner tube and paint it. Take a clock mechanism from any watch, thread it through the wheel, attach the hands, and you're done. You can draw numbers, paint the arrows a different color, decorate the knitting needles with various interesting details, whatever your imagination allows.
